Antonija Matić
NCC-HR
Antonija Matić is a formally educated economist with PhD in the scientific field of social science, with experience in banking and EU programs and projects. She started her career in 2002 in the banking sector, where she gained most experience as a Financial Advisor for SMEs. In 2015 she started working at the Academy of Arts and Culture, first as a Lecturer and then as the Head of the Department for Science, Art, EU Projects and Programmes and Interinstitutional Cooperation. She worked there as a Coordinator and Financial Manager on EU projects (Creative Europe, Erasmus +, Interreg). She was also a member of the international conferences organization team and coordinator of different national projects. Since 2024. she has been working in the Croatian Academic and Research Network - CARNET as the Head of the Office for the European Union Financial Support Services, in the National Coordination Center for Industry, Technology and Research in Cyber Security.
